The Worldwide Olympic Committee (IOC) has issued a warning to nations that exclude athletes from competitors for political causes, cautioning that such actions might have penalties for his or her plans to host future Olympic Video games.
This warning comes amid issues in regards to the growing politicization of sports activities.
Whereas particular nations weren’t recognized, Poland and Indonesia have expressed curiosity in internet hosting the 2036 Olympics, the subsequent accessible Summer season Video games to be awarded. Poland had beforehand refused to permit Russian athletes to compete within the European Video games, whereas Indonesia misplaced its internet hosting rights for the boys’s Below-20 World Cup resulting from its reluctance to stage video games involving Israel.

Kolinda Grabar-Kitarović, an IOC member and former president of Croatia, highlighted the difficulty of presidency restrictions on athletes’ entry to worldwide sporting competitions throughout an IOC annual assembly in Mumbai. She confused the significance of all potential hosts committing to abide by the IOC’s code of ethics and guidelines of conduct.
Grabar-Kitarović chairs the IOC panel that engages with potential Summer season Video games bidders, and he or she emphasised that any violation of the Olympic Constitution can be considered all through the dialogue with potential hosts.
The choice on the host for the 2036 Olympics is predicted to be made “not earlier than 2026 or 2027” by a brand new course of that avoids public campaigns and contested votes. As an alternative, potential hosts work with the IOC behind the scenes, resulting in a most popular candidate getting into an unique negotiating interval to refine their plans.
The IOC’s advice for the 2030 and 2034 Winter Olympics hosts to be chosen concurrently in Paris was accredited by IOC members. Sweden, France, Switzerland, and america are among the many potential bidders for these editions.
